Explore Louisville's unique bourbon whiskey history and its influence today through a free "Whiskey Walking Tour" in downtown Louisville, KY Immerse yourself in Louisville’s special bourbon whiskey history by joining us for a free “Whiskey Walking Tour”. A “Looking at Louisville” walking tour guide will take you on a ten-block journey through downtown Louisville, sharing their knowledge of pre-Prohibition Louisville and the boom of bourbon on Whiskey Row that is still taking place to this day. All tours start and end at the Louisville Visitor Center and last 90 minutes. Tours are capped at 8 participants and walk-ins only taken based upon availability. Tours are weather pending.
